#898113 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#898113 is composed of 53.7% red, 50.6%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.8% magenta, 86.1%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 55.9 degrees, a saturation of 75.6% and a lightness of 30.6%. #898113 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ff26 with #130300.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

Shades and Tints of #898113

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100f02 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#898113

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#535249 is the less saturated color, while #9b9101 is the most saturated one.
